Here is an issue I have noticed - not sure if this is specific to a problem with my local config, or a general thing - so please do chime in...
1) Whenever I update my config via the 'Settings' tab of the web UI, setupVars.conf ends up being set to 600 - which then leads to the issue that the nginx user http cannot read it and an error message on accessing the tab again until I manually chmod 644 again.
2) A similar issue occurs with gravity.db. After I trigger a 'gravity update' via the web ui, gravity.db turns 644 instead of 664 that it needs to be in order for the nginx user http to be able to have write access to that db (which is necessary for editing block lists via the web UI).
So... Have I somehow borked my setup, or is this something that other nginx user also experience?
Pinned Comments
max.bra commented on 2018-02-09 16:45 (UTC) (edited on 2019-10-18 23:14 (UTC) by max.bra)
ArchLinux Pi-hole is not officially supported by Pi-hole project. In case of bugs and malfunctions please DO NOT file a report upstream.
First of all check if the wiki (https://wiki.archlinux.org/index.php/Pi-hole) can help then ask here for assistance and tips.
When it will be excluded that the problem does not depend on ArchLinux we will file a bug upstream.